2-strokes
simple mechanics =
less temperamental
less maintenance
lighter engine
combustion on the very stroke =
higher rpm over higher torque
4-strokes
more complicated mechanics =
prettier to look at (particularly open rockers and saito hemis)
more rewarding to work on
combustion on every other rotation =
more efficient on gas
more complete burn (no exhaust gases)
deeper more pleasant exhaust note
overall the 4-strokes of the same displacement will turn a prop larger than a 2-stroke at the same RPM. yes 2-strokes can turn a tiny prop at huge rpms but for all around tractability, a 4-stroke will kick the pants off a 2-stroke.
